RPC漏洞修复,保障系统安全的关键环节

喜羊羊

随着信息技术的飞速发展,远程过程调用(RPC)作为一种重要的跨平台通信手段,广泛应用于各类软件系统中,随着RPC技术的普及和应用场景的不断扩展,其安全问题也日益凸显,尤其是RPC漏洞的存在,给系统安全带来了极大的威胁,对RPC漏洞的修复成为了保障系统安全的关键环节。

RPC漏洞概述

RPC漏洞是指远程过程调用过程中存在的安全漏洞,主要包括以下几个方面:

1、身份验证漏洞:由于RPC通信过程中涉及跨平台传输,若身份验证机制不完善,攻击者可能伪造合法用户身份进行非法操作。

2、授权漏洞:部分RPC系统在处理权限时存在缺陷,导致攻击者获得不应拥有的权限,进而对系统造成破坏。

RPC漏洞修复,保障系统安全的关键环节

3、保密性漏洞:若RPC通信过程中数据加密措施不到位,攻击者可能截获通信数据,导致敏感信息泄露。

4、拒绝服务攻击(DoS):针对RPC服务的攻击可能导致服务瘫痪,影响系统正常运行。

RPC漏洞修复的重要性

RPC漏洞修复的重要性主要体现在以下几个方面:

1、保障数据安全:修复RPC漏洞可以确保系统数据在传输过程中的安全性,防止敏感信息泄露。

2、提升系统稳定性:修复RPC漏洞可以避免因攻击导致的服务瘫痪,保障系统正常运行。

3、提高系统安全性:通过修复身份验证和授权等方面的漏洞,提高系统的安全防护能力

4、降低安全风险:及时修复RPC漏洞可以降低系统遭受攻击的风险,避免造成重大损失。

RPC漏洞修复策略

针对RPC漏洞修复,可以采取以下策略:

1、完善身份验证机制:采用强密码策略、多因素身份认证等手段,确保通信双方身份的真实性。

2、加强授权管理:严格区分用户权限,确保每个用户只能访问其权限范围内的资源。

3、强化数据加密:采用加密通信协议,确保数据在传输过程中的安全性。

RPC漏洞修复,保障系统安全的关键环节

4、定期安全审计:定期对系统进行安全审计,发现潜在的安全风险并及时修复。

5、建立应急响应机制:建立快速响应的应急响应团队,及时发现并处理安全事件。

具体实施步骤

1、漏洞扫描:使用专业的漏洞扫描工具对系统进行全面扫描,发现存在的RPC漏洞。

2、风险评估:对扫描发现的漏洞进行风险评估,确定漏洞的严重程度和修复优先级。

3、漏洞修复:根据风险评估结果,对漏洞进行修复,修复过程中应遵循最佳实践和安全标准。

4、测试验证:修复完成后,对系统进行测试验证,确保漏洞已被成功修复,且不影响系统正常运行。

5、监控与更新:修复完成后,继续对系统进行监控,确保系统安全,定期更新系统和软件,以应对新出现的安全威胁。

案例分析

以某公司RPC漏洞修复案例为例,该公司通过定期安全审计发现了一处身份验证漏洞,攻击者可以利用该漏洞伪造合法用户身份进行非法操作,该公司立即组织应急响应团队进行漏洞修复工作,采取了加强身份验证、更新加密技术等措施,修复完成后,该公司对系统进行测试验证,确保漏洞已被成功修复,经过一段时间的监控,系统安全性得到了显著提升。

RPC漏洞修复是保障系统安全的关键环节,为了提升系统安全性,降低安全风险,应采取完善的RPC漏洞修复策略,通过定期安全审计、漏洞扫描、风险评估、漏洞修复、测试验证等手段,确保系统安全稳定运行,建立应急响应机制,及时处理安全事件,降低损失。

文章版权声明:除非注明,否则均为欣依网原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
AddoilApplauseBadlaughBombCoffeeFabulousFacepalmFecesFrownHeyhaInsidiousKeepFightingNoProbPigHeadShockedSinistersmileSlapSocialSweatTolaughWatermelonWittyWowYeahYellowdog
评论列表 (暂无评论,1人围观)

还没有评论,来说两句吧...

目录[+]